WebDec 1, 2016 · If the issue is still unresolved, you can try another method for restoring sound: Launch the Start Menu, search for Device Manager and then launch it. Expand Sound and audio devices. Right-click on the current sound driver and choose uninstall. Finally, click on Scan for hardware changes and the updated driver will be automatically installed.
